    Meaning

    The name Toshiaki is deeply rooted in Japanese culture, reflecting traditional values and aspirations.

    It consists of two kanji characters, each carrying significant meaning:

    “Toshi” (俊) translates to “outstanding,” “brilliant,” or “handsome.” It often symbolizes intelligence, talent, and noble qualities.

    “Aki” (明) means “bright,” “clear,” “intelligent,” or “lucid.” It suggests enlightenment, wisdom, and a clear understanding of the world.

    Together, Toshiaki embodies the ideal of a person who is not only physically attractive but also possesses exceptional intellect, moral integrity, and a brilliant mind.

    This name resonates with traditional Japanese ideals of education, refinement, and social standing, reflecting a desire for excellence in all aspects of life.
